6.3.7. Front Panel Button Lock Outs
The front panel operate and remote buttons can be independently enabled or disabled. It may be
desirable to disable (or lock) one or both of these buttons to prevent changes from being made on
the front panel when the power supply is being remotely controlled. Note that when the power
supply is in remote control mode (RMT lamp is on) settings cannot be changed from the front
panel, but the operate state can still be changed by pressing the operate switch on the front panel.
To prevent changes to settings or the operate state made from the front panel the power supply
can be put into remote control mode (RMT lamp is on) and then both the remote and operate
switches can be disabled (locked).
CAUTION:
If the operate switch is disabled (locked) the operate state can no longer be changed
from the front panel. Operate/standby control must be accomplished using the inhibit input or the
host port (see
8.0.Remote Operate/Standby Control
for details on how to remotely control the
operate/standby state).
